<?php
include_once $_SERVER['DOCUMENT_ROOT'] . '/include/shared-manual.inc';
$TOC = array();
$TOC_DEPRECATED = array();
$PARENTS = array();
include_once dirname(__FILE__) ."/toc/book.xml.inc";
$setup = array (
  'home' => 
  array (
    0 => 'index.php',
    1 => 'PHP Manual',
  ),
  'head' => 
  array (
    0 => 'UTF-8',
    1 => 'en',
  ),
  'this' => 
  array (
    0 => 'xml.constants.php',
    1 => 'Predefined Constants',
    2 => 'Predefined Constants',
  ),
  'up' => 
  array (
    0 => 'book.xml.php',
    1 => 'XML Parser',
  ),
  'prev' => 
  array (
    0 => 'xml.resources.php',
    1 => 'Resource Types',
  ),
  'next' => 
  array (
    0 => 'xml.eventhandlers.php',
    1 => 'Event Handlers',
  ),
  'alternatives' => 
  array (
  ),
  'source' => 
  array (
    'lang' => 'en',
    'path' => 'reference/xml/constants.xml',
  ),
  'history' => 
  array (
  ),
);
$setup["toc"] = $TOC;
$setup["toc_deprecated"] = $TOC_DEPRECATED;
$setup["parents"] = $PARENTS;
manual_setup($setup);

contributors($setup);

?>
<div id="xml.constants" class="appendix">
 <h1 class="title">Predefined Constants</h1>

 <p class="simpara">
The constants below are defined by this extension, and
will only be available when the extension has either
been compiled into PHP or dynamically loaded at runtime.
</p>
 <dl>
  
   <dt id="constant.xml-error-none">
    <strong><code><a href="xml.constants.php#constant.xml-error-none">XML_ERROR_NONE</a></code></strong>
    (<span class="type"><a href="language.types.integer.php" class="type int">int</a></span>)
   </dt>
   <dd>
    <span class="simpara">
     
    </span>
   </dd>
  
  
   <dt id="constant.xml-error-no-memory">
    <strong><code><a href="xml.constants.php#constant.xml-error-no-memory">XML_ERROR_NO_MEMORY</a></code></strong>
    (<span class="type"><a href="language.types.integer.php" class="type int">int</a></span>)
   </dt>
   <dd>
    <span class="simpara">
     
    </span>
   </dd>
  
  
   <dt id="constant.xml-error-syntax">
    <strong><code><a href="xml.constants.php#constant.xml-error-syntax">XML_ERROR_SYNTAX</a></code></strong>
    (<span class="type"><a href="language.types.integer.php" class="type int">int</a></span>)
   </dt>
   <dd>
    <span class="simpara">
     
    </span>
   </dd>
  
  
   <dt id="constant.xml-error-no-elements">
    <strong><code><a href="xml.constants.php#constant.xml-error-no-elements">XML_ERROR_NO_ELEMENTS</a></code></strong>
    (<span class="type"><a href="language.types.integer.php" class="type int">int</a></span>)
   </dt>
   <dd>
    <span class="simpara">
     
    </span>
   </dd>
  
  
   <dt id="constant.xml-error-invalid-token">
    <strong><code><a href="xml.constants.php#constant.xml-error-invalid-token">XML_ERROR_INVALID_TOKEN</a></code></strong>
    (<span class="type"><a href="language.types.integer.php" class="type int">int</a></span>)
   </dt>
   <dd>
    <span class="simpara">
     
    </span>
   </dd>
  
  
   <dt id="constant.xml-error-unclosed-token">
    <strong><code><a href="xml.constants.php#constant.xml-error-unclosed-token">XML_ERROR_UNCLOSED_TOKEN</a></code></strong>
    (<span class="type"><a href="language.types.integer.php" class="type int">int</a></span>)
   </dt>
   <dd>
    <span class="simpara">
     
    </span>
   </dd>
  
  
   <dt id="constant.xml-error-partial-char">
    <strong><code><a href="xml.constants.php#constant.xml-error-partial-char">XML_ERROR_PARTIAL_CHAR</a></code></strong>
    (<span class="type"><a href="language.types.integer.php" class="type int">int</a></span>)
   </dt>
   <dd>
    <span class="simpara">
     
    </span>
   </dd>
  
  
   <dt id="constant.xml-error-tag-mismatch">
    <strong><code><a href="xml.constants.php#constant.xml-error-tag-mismatch">XML_ERROR_TAG_MISMATCH</a></code></strong>
    (<span class="type"><a href="language.types.integer.php" class="type int">int</a></span>)
   </dt>
   <dd>
    <span class="simpara">
     
    </span>
   </dd>
  
  
   <dt id="constant.xml-error-duplicate-attribute">
    <strong><code><a href="xml.constants.php#constant.xml-error-duplicate-attribute">XML_ERROR_DUPLICATE_ATTRIBUTE</a></code></strong>
    (<span class="type"><a href="language.types.integer.php" class="type int">int</a></span>)
   </dt>
   <dd>
    <span class="simpara">
     
    </span>
   </dd>
  
  
   <dt id="constant.xml-error-junk-after-doc-element">
    <strong><code><a href="xml.constants.php#constant.xml-error-junk-after-doc-element">XML_ERROR_JUNK_AFTER_DOC_ELEMENT</a></code></strong>
    (<span class="type"><a href="language.types.integer.php" class="type int">int</a></span>)
   </dt>
   <dd>
    <span class="simpara">
     
    </span>
   </dd>
  
  
   <dt id="constant.xml-error-param-entity-ref">
    <strong><code><a href="xml.constants.php#constant.xml-error-param-entity-ref">XML_ERROR_PARAM_ENTITY_REF</a></code></strong>
    (<span class="type"><a href="language.types.integer.php" class="type int">int</a></span>)
   </dt>
   <dd>
    <span class="simpara">
     
    </span>
   </dd>
  
  
   <dt id="constant.xml-error-undefined-entity">
    <strong><code><a href="xml.constants.php#constant.xml-error-undefined-entity">XML_ERROR_UNDEFINED_ENTITY</a></code></strong>
    (<span class="type"><a href="language.types.integer.php" class="type int">int</a></span>)
   </dt>
   <dd>
    <span class="simpara">
     
    </span>
   </dd>
  
  
   <dt id="constant.xml-error-recursive-entity-ref">
    <strong><code><a href="xml.constants.php#constant.xml-error-recursive-entity-ref">XML_ERROR_RECURSIVE_ENTITY_REF</a></code></strong>
    (<span class="type"><a href="language.types.integer.php" class="type int">int</a></span>)
   </dt>
   <dd>
    <span class="simpara">
     
    </span>
   </dd>
  
  
   <dt id="constant.xml-error-async-entity">
    <strong><code><a href="xml.constants.php#constant.xml-error-async-entity">XML_ERROR_ASYNC_ENTITY</a></code></strong>
    (<span class="type"><a href="language.types.integer.php" class="type int">int</a></span>)
   </dt>
   <dd>
    <span class="simpara">
     
    </span>
   </dd>
  
  
   <dt id="constant.xml-error-bad-char-ref">
    <strong><code><a href="xml.constants.php#constant.xml-error-bad-char-ref">XML_ERROR_BAD_CHAR_REF</a></code></strong>
    (<span class="type"><a href="language.types.integer.php" class="type int">int</a></span>)
   </dt>
   <dd>
    <span class="simpara">
     
    </span>
   </dd>
  
  
   <dt id="constant.xml-error-binary-entity-ref">
    <strong><code><a href="xml.constants.php#constant.xml-error-binary-entity-ref">XML_ERROR_BINARY_ENTITY_REF</a></code></strong>
    (<span class="type"><a href="language.types.integer.php" class="type int">int</a></span>)
   </dt>
   <dd>
    <span class="simpara">
     
    </span>
   </dd>
  
  
   <dt id="constant.xml-error-attribute-external-entity-ref">
    <strong><code><a href="xml.constants.php#constant.xml-error-attribute-external-entity-ref">XML_ERROR_ATTRIBUTE_EXTERNAL_ENTITY_REF</a></code></strong>
    (<span class="type"><a href="language.types.integer.php" class="type int">int</a></span>)
   </dt>
   <dd>
    <span class="simpara">
     
    </span>
   </dd>
  
  
   <dt id="constant.xml-error-misplaced-xml-pi">
    <strong><code><a href="xml.constants.php#constant.xml-error-misplaced-xml-pi">XML_ERROR_MISPLACED_XML_PI</a></code></strong>
    (<span class="type"><a href="language.types.integer.php" class="type int">int</a></span>)
   </dt>
   <dd>
    <span class="simpara">
     
    </span>
   </dd>
  
  
   <dt id="constant.xml-error-unknown-encoding">
    <strong><code><a href="xml.constants.php#constant.xml-error-unknown-encoding">XML_ERROR_UNKNOWN_ENCODING</a></code></strong>
    (<span class="type"><a href="language.types.integer.php" class="type int">int</a></span>)
   </dt>
   <dd>
    <span class="simpara">
     
    </span>
   </dd>
  
  
   <dt id="constant.xml-error-incorrect-encoding">
    <strong><code><a href="xml.constants.php#constant.xml-error-incorrect-encoding">XML_ERROR_INCORRECT_ENCODING</a></code></strong>
    (<span class="type"><a href="language.types.integer.php" class="type int">int</a></span>)
   </dt>
   <dd>
    <span class="simpara">
     
    </span>
   </dd>
  
  
   <dt id="constant.xml-error-unclosed-cdata-section">
    <strong><code><a href="xml.constants.php#constant.xml-error-unclosed-cdata-section">XML_ERROR_UNCLOSED_CDATA_SECTION</a></code></strong>
    (<span class="type"><a href="language.types.integer.php" class="type int">int</a></span>)
   </dt>
   <dd>
    <span class="simpara">
     
    </span>
   </dd>
  
  
   <dt id="constant.xml-error-external-entity-handling">
    <strong><code><a href="xml.constants.php#constant.xml-error-external-entity-handling">XML_ERROR_EXTERNAL_ENTITY_HANDLING</a></code></strong>
    (<span class="type"><a href="language.types.integer.php" class="type int">int</a></span>)
   </dt>
   <dd>
    <span class="simpara">
     
    </span>
   </dd>
  
  
   <dt id="constant.xml-option-case-folding">
    <strong><code><a href="xml.constants.php#constant.xml-option-case-folding">XML_OPTION_CASE_FOLDING</a></code></strong>
    (<span class="type"><a href="language.types.integer.php" class="type int">int</a></span>)
   </dt>
   <dd>
    <span class="simpara">
     
    </span>
   </dd>
  
  
   <dt id="constant.xml-option-parse-huge">
    <strong><code><a href="xml.constants.php#constant.xml-option-parse-huge">XML_OPTION_PARSE_HUGE</a></code></strong>
    (<span class="type"><a href="language.types.integer.php" class="type int">int</a></span>)
   </dt>
   <dd>
    <span class="simpara">
     Available as of PHP 8.4.0.
     When libxml2 &lt; 2.7.0 is used (e.g. on PHP 7.x),
     this option is enabled by default and cannot be disabled.
    </span>
   </dd>
  
  
   <dt id="constant.xml-option-target-encoding">
    <strong><code><a href="xml.constants.php#constant.xml-option-target-encoding">XML_OPTION_TARGET_ENCODING</a></code></strong>
    (<span class="type"><a href="language.types.integer.php" class="type int">int</a></span>)
   </dt>
   <dd>
    <span class="simpara">
     
    </span>
   </dd>
  
  
   <dt id="constant.xml-option-skip-tagstart">
    <strong><code><a href="xml.constants.php#constant.xml-option-skip-tagstart">XML_OPTION_SKIP_TAGSTART</a></code></strong>
    (<span class="type"><a href="language.types.integer.php" class="type int">int</a></span>)
   </dt>
   <dd>
    <span class="simpara">
     
    </span>
   </dd>
  
  
   <dt id="constant.xml-option-skip-white">
    <strong><code><a href="xml.constants.php#constant.xml-option-skip-white">XML_OPTION_SKIP_WHITE</a></code></strong>
    (<span class="type"><a href="language.types.integer.php" class="type int">int</a></span>)
   </dt>
   <dd>
    <span class="simpara">
     
    </span>
   </dd>
  
  
   <dt id="constant.xml-sax-impl">
    <strong><code><a href="xml.constants.php#constant.xml-sax-impl">XML_SAX_IMPL</a></code></strong>
    (<span class="type"><a href="language.types.string.php" class="type string">string</a></span>)
   </dt>
   <dd>
    <span class="simpara">
     Holds the SAX implementation method.
     Can be <code class="literal">libxml</code> or <code class="literal">expat</code>.
    </span>
   </dd>
  
 </dl>
</div>
<?php manual_footer($setup); ?>